Output b81cecc591b8e63d15a89872051f7d2043e13d0bfd624b966a00ca3c01aa48cb:0

value
714441
script pubkey
OP_0 OP_PUSHBYTES_20 29c1603fc3d5444af7aa1c5eeb4d6aaa4ebcb6f5
address
bc1q98qkq07r64zy4aa2r30wknt24f8tedh4d89f2z
transaction
b81cecc591b8e63d15a89872051f7d2043e13d0bfd624b966a00ca3c01aa48cb
confirmations
11929
spent
true